When is the best time for a budget trip to Arganda del Rey?
Weather will likely play an important role when you plan your trip to Arganda del Rey, but bear in mind that cheaper options are usually available when the weather isn't as good.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 25°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 7°C. Average annual precipitation for Arganda del Rey is 445 mm.

How can I get to Arganda del Rey and get around on a budget?
Scoping out the transportation options in Arganda del Rey is a smart way to keep your trip affordable. The nearest airport is Madrid (MAD-Adolfo Suárez Madrid-Barajas), 12.8 mi (20.7 km) away. Local metro stations include Arganda del Rey Station and La Poveda Station.
